Board; Powers and Duties

Sec. 4. The board has the powers and duties prescribed by IC 8-1.5-3-4. In addition, the board:

(1) may hold hearings following public notice;

(2) may make findings and determinations;

(3) may design, order, contract for or construct pumping plants or stations, filtration plants, reservoirs, water mains, hydrants, and other equipment, structures, and appurtenances and rebuild, equip, improve, extend, and repair plants, equipment, and structures;

(4) may build or have built all roads, levees, walls, or other structures that may be necessary or desirable in connection with waterworks;

(5) make all necessary or desirable improvements of the grounds and premises under its control;

(6) may issue and sell bonds for the construction, alteration, addition, or extension to the waterworks, in the manner prescribed by law, including the provisions of IC 8-1.5-2; and

(7) shall furnish an adequate supply of water to consumers within the waterworks district.

As added by Acts 1982, P.L.74, SEC.1.
